GOVERNOR GENERAL of New Zealand, Dame Patsy Reddy, is looking forward to keen cricket when the West Indies team tour New Zealand in November.

“At the moment it’s very exciting. I was not aware of it, and it was pointed out to me that the Test series between our two nations are drawn, with each having won the same number, so this series will be a decider as to who will have the upper hand. We’re looking forward to a very good contest,” she said during her first tour of Kensington Oval and Barbados, yesterday. 

The last time West Indies toured New Zealand was in 2013 when New Zealand won the Test series 2-1.

Also touring the facility with her, was her husband, David Gascoigne and High Commissioner Jan Henderson. (RA)
